Dorothea’s holiday house is in a quiet residential location on the outskirts and has a large fenced garden of around 1500m².
There is a roofed sitting area outside with wooden garden furniture. There is also a grill. There are sun loungers on the large lawn for relaxing. The site includes a idyllic gazebo with a garden bench. Parking spaces are available by the house itself and in the immediate vicinity. Note that the house is non-smoking.
It is on two floors and was completely renovated in 2012. The ground floor has a generous hallway, a comfortably furnished living and dining room with a corner bench group, a sitting corner, a TV and stereo system, a kitchen-diner renovated in 2017 with a sitting corner, a ceramic hob and oven, dishwasher, fridge, electric universal cutter, kettle and coffee machine, a WC and a little adjoining conservatory. The first floor comprises three bedrooms, one with a double bed, a large built-in cupboard with mirrors on the door and a balcony, the second with two single beds (90 x 200cm), the third also with a built-in cupboard and a double sofa bed. This room also has a balcony. The first floor also includes a bathroom with a shower and WC. A washing machine and dryer are available on request.
It is a three-minute walk to the nearest train stop (Seehäslebahn Stockach-Radolfzell) along a path and about 200 metres to the centre with shops and various restaurants. It is2km to the heated swimming pool and a supermarket. You can enjoy golf, riding and tennis. There is a well-developed network of cycling and hiking trails throughout the Hegau and Lake Coantance area. You can visit the castle ruins at the nearby Hegauberge or go on wonderful trips into the landscapes all around the lake, such as the Mainau flower island or the Reichenau vegetable island, or Switzerland to the picturesque little town Stein am Rhein or Schaffhausen with the famous Rheinfall. The medieval towns Konstanz and Meersburg, accessed by ferry, are also worth a visit, as well as the spa town Überlingen with a Mediterranean flair. The baroque Birnau monastery affords a wonderful view over Obersee and the Alpine chain. The Zeppelinmuseum and Dorniermuseum in Friedrichshafen invite technology enthusiasts to pay a visit. It is worth going on a trip to the nearby Donautal hiking area, where the Danube meanders between craggy cliffs, along with the Beuron monastery and Burg Wildenstein.
